Electromagnetic corrections to the ratio between charged and uncharged pions produced along with either a triton or helium-3 from 600-Mev protons incident on deuterium have been estimated. It was found that the main correction comes from the difference in triton and helium-3 wave functions. It was not found possible to correct unambiguously for the effects of mass difference between charged and uncharged pions. An enhancement of around 10% of positive pions was obtained with an estimated uncertainty of +/-3%. The result agrees with experiments at CERN.
